Common Lisp the Language


Common_Lisp_the_Language

Common Lispの言語がある参考書のセットに関するガイ・スティールによる技術基準およびプログラミング言語という名前のCommon Lisp。

コンテンツ
1 歴史
1.1 標準化する前に 1.2 標準化中 1.3 標準化後
2 も参照してください
3 外部リンク

歴史

標準化する前に
初版(Digital Press、1984; ISBN  0-932376-41-X ; 465ページ)は、Guy L. Steele Jr.、Scott E. Fahlman、Richard P. Gabriel、David A. Moon、およびDanielLによって作成されました。ウェインレブ。これは、米国規格協会(ANSI)によるCommon Lisp技術標準の基礎として機能したため、ANSI CommonLispと呼ばれています。

標準化中
第2版​​(Digital Press、1990;
ISBN 1-55558-041-6 ; 1029ページ)はGuy L. Steele Jrによって書かれました。これは、標準化プロセスの当時の状況を反映し、CommonLispなどの重要な新機能を文書化したものです。オブジェクトシステム(CLOS)、マクロ、および条件。また、シリーズとジェネレータに関する章も loop

標準化後
ANSI Common Lisp標準は1994年に公開され、 Common Lisp the Language(1984)およびCommon Lisp the Language、Second Edition(1990)で説明されている言語方言とは異なります。実質的な追加と削除は、第2版の時点からANSI CommonLispの最終バージョンまでの間に行われました。また、シリーズとジェネレーターは、第2版の付録で説明されていますが、作業ドラフトの一部でも、ANSI CommonLispの最終バージョンでもありませんでした。
ANSI CommonLispとCommonLisp the Languageの2つのエディションで記述されている言語方言は異なりますが、ANSI Common Lisp仕様は、予約語(キーワード)を明示的に提案することにより、 Common Lisp the Language (第1版と第2版)の実用的な重要性を間接的に認めています。リストに含まれる可能性があるため、ANSI CommonLispと他の方言の間で相互運用する必要のあるコードに条件を追加できるようにします。:cltl1:cltl2*features*

も参照してください
Common Lisp HyperSpec(ANSI Common Lisp標準のハイパーテキストバージョン)

外部リンク
Common Lisp the Language、第2版オンラインHTMLバージョン。( LaTeXソースを含むいくつかのダウンロード可能なフォーマットも提供します。)
ミラーサイト(標準サイトがオフラインの場合)
lisp.seが提供するミラー
supelec.frが提供するミラー
Stub
  Stub icon 2
  コンピュータの本または一連の本に関するこ
image
「 https://en.wikipedia.org/w/index.php?title=Common_Lisp_the_Language&oldid=1049075761」
から取得”